During this camp, you will be recreating the discovery of a new particle using real data from a major particle accelerator, writing your own an analysis in the Python programming language.
No prior background in computer programming is needed – we will teach you all you need to know, and many helpful graduate students will be on hand to work with you on any aspects you find difficult.

This camp serves as an excellent basic introduction to computer programming, as well as a primer in particle physics, and students of all levels of proficiency at coding have enjoyed the camp in the past.
